How to prepare for a job interview at Home Group Limited

Know Your Stuff

Make sure you understand the role of a Housing Management Coordinator inside out. Familiarise yourself with tenancy support processes and the specific needs of customers in housing. This will show your potential employer that you're genuinely interested and ready to hit the ground running.

Showcase Your Skills

Prepare examples from your past experiences that highlight your skills in customer service, problem-solving, and communication. Think about situations where you've successfully supported tenants or resolved issues, as these will resonate well with the interviewers.

Ask Smart Questions

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are thoughtful questions about the company’s approach to housing management and how they support their staff. This not only shows your interest but also hel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
